Moreover, is Halal Guys Egyptian?
Meet the original “The Halal Guys”: Mohamed Abouelenein, Ahmed Elsaka, and Abdelbaset Elsayed. They are the founding members of our growing franchise. These Egyptian immigrants traveled to the United States in hopes of a better life and set their sights on becoming a true American entrepreneurial success story.
Can Muslims eat kosher?
It’s not generally known outside the circles of the preoccupied, but Muslims who can’t get meat slaughtered according to the rules of halal, the Muslim equivalent of the kosher laws, are permitted by most Muslim clerics to eat kosher instead.
Is McDonald’s halal in USA?
None of our menu items are Halal. Our restaurant operations do not allow us to separate halal products from our regular McDonald’s items nor can we ensure other products in the restaurant meet the standard required for halal designations.

Does halal mean no pork?
According to the Muslims in Dietetics and Nutrition, a member group of the Academy of Nutrition and Dietetics, Halal food can never contain pork or pork products (that includes gelatin and shortenings), or any alcohol.
What is the white sauce on halal?
Here are some things that, in the two decades it’s been around, intrepid food writers and recipe tinkerers have determined were a part of the Halal Guys’ famed white sauce: Half mayo, half Greek yogurt. Miracle Whip, not mayo. Ranch dressing, Greek yogurt, and sour cream.
